shithub: git9

Download patch

ref: 137053f83a65f32de2e8a29c1e635391decbbb37
parent: dfa936709698206cc881b2cbd6127532d1e8387c
author: Ori Bernstein <[email protected]>
date: Sun May 10 22:32:01 EDT 2020

sync dir permissions with upstream git

upstream git uses 0040000 for directory permissions,
we should follow suit.

--- a/save.c
+++ b/save.c
@@ -18,7 +18,7 @@
 gitmode(int m)
 {
 	if(m & DMDIR)		/* directory */
-		return 0040755;
+		return 0040000;
 	else if(m & 0111)	/* executable */
 		return 0100755;
 	else if(m != 0)		/* regular */